Transaction fa75eaf675fc4d247763c48c83fa10657f4035d0ecd12f66ee4ac739e0eee9ed

block
e6980b0c7a401f472288b4aba67b20e19d500be078e814fb7adf856e35bab8db

35 Inputs

2 Outputs